Beloved, novel by toni morrison, published in 1987 and winner of the 1988 pulitzer prize.

Just before baby suggss death, sethes two sons, howard and buglar, ran away. Most of the characters believe that the womanwho calls herself belovedis the embodied spirit of sethes dead daughter, and the novel provides a wealth of evidence supporting this interpretation. The satire in evelyn waughs darkly comic novel the loved one was originally doubleedged. The work examines the destructive legacy of slavery as it chronicles the life of a black woman named sethe, from her precivil war days as a slave in kentucky to her time in cincinnati, ohio, in 1873. Sethes motherinlaw, baby suggs, lived with them until her death eight years earlier.

Then, isolated and alone together for years, the three women will cling to one another as mother, daughter, and sisterfound at last and redeemed. Set after the american civil war 186165, it is inspired by the life of margaret garner, an african american who escaped slavery in kentucky in late january 1856 by crossing the ohio river to ohio, a free state. Now sethe is free, and lives in a frame house on a few acres on the outskirts of cincinnati124 bluestone road, the film informs us, as if it would be an ordinary house if it were not for the poltergeist that haunts it.
